Today in Metal History – November 1st

Albums Release

November 1st 1982

Venom – “Black Metal”

“Black Metal” is the second album by English black metal band Venom. The title track, “Black Metal” is a standout from Venom “Black Metal” album.

November 1st 1982

Night Ranger – “Dawn Patrol”

“Dawn Patrol” is the debut studio album by American hard rock band Night Ranger. “Don’t Tell Me You Love Me” is a standout from “Dawn Patrol”.

November 1st 1986

Kreator – “Pleasure To Kill”

“Pleasure To Kill” is the second studio album by German thrash metal band Kreator. “Riot of Violence” is a standout “Pleasure To Kill”.

November 1st 1988

Crimson Glory – “Transcendence”

“Transcendence” is the second studio album by American power metal band Crimson Glory. “Lonely” is a standout from “Transcendence”.

November 1st 1988

Ratt – “Reach For The Sky”

“Reach For The Sky” is the fourth studio album by American glam metal band Ratt. “I Want a Woman” is a standout from “Reach For The Sky”.

November 1st 1992

HeavensGate – “Hell for Sale!”

“Hell for Sale!” is the fourth album by German power metal band Heavens Gate. “Under Fire” is a standout from “Hell for Sale!”.

November 1st 1992

Amorphis – “The Karelian Isthmus”

“The Karelian Isthmus” is the debut studio album by Finnish death metal band Amorphis. “The Gathering” is a standout from “The Karelian Isthmus”.

November 1st 1993

Immortal – “Pure Holocaust”

“Pure Holocaust” is the second album by Norwegian black metal band Immortal. The Sun No Longer Rises is a standout “Pure Holocaust”.

November 1st 1994

Megadeth – “Youthanasia”

“Youthanasia” is the sixth studio album by American thrash metal band Megadeth. “Reckoning Day” is a standout from “Youthanasia”.

November 1st 1994

Threshold – “Psychedelicatessen

“Psychedelicatessen” is the second album by the English progressive metal band Threshold. “Into the Light” is a standout from “Psychedelicatessen.

November 1st 1997

Nightwish – “Angels Fall First”

“Angels Fall First” is the debut studio album by Finnish symphonic metal band Nightwish. “Elvenpath” is a standout from “Angels Fall First”.

November 1st 2002

Lordi – “Get Heavy”

“Get Heavy” is the debut studio album by Finnish rock band Lordi. “Get Heavy” is a standout from debut album.

November 1st 2010

Cradle Of Filth – “Darkly, Darkly, Venus Aversa”

“Darkly, Darkly, Venus Aversa” is the ninth studio album by English extreme metal band Cradle of Filth. “Lilith Immaculate” is a standout from “Darkly, Darkly, Venus Aversa”.

November 1st 2011

Megadeth – “Thirteen”

“Thirteen” (stylized as Th1rt3en) is the thirteenth studio album by American thrash metal band Megadeth. “Sudden Death” is a standout from “Thirteen”.

November 1st 2019

Angel Witch – “Angel of Light”

“Angel of Light” is the fifth studio album by British heavy metal band Angel Witch. “The Night is Calling” is a standout from “Angel of Light”.

Single Release

November 1st 1976

Kiss – “Hard Luck Woman”

“Hard Luck Woman” is a song by American hard rock band Kiss. Released as lead single from their album “Rock and Roll Over”.

November 1st 2010

Kamelot – “Where the Wild Roses Grow”

“Where the Wild Roses Grow” is a song performed by American symphonic metal band Kamelot, featuring Finnish vocalist Elize Ryd. Released on their album “Haven”.

November 1st 2010

Apocalyptica – “Not Strong Enough”

“Not Strong Enough” is a song by Finnish cello metal band Apocalyptica. Released as a third single from their seventh studio album “7th Symphony”.

November 1st 2013

Tarja – “500 Letters”

“500 Letters” is a song by Finnish symphonic metal singer Tarja Turunen. Released as a single from her fourth studio album Colours in the Dark.

November 1st 2024

Exodus – “Beating Around the Bush”

“Beating Around the Bush” is a song covered by American thrash metal band Exodus. Originally by AC/DC, it appears on the tribute album “AC/DC We Salute You”.

Metal Birthday

November 1st 1963

Rick Allen – Def Leppard

Richard John Cyril Allen is an English musician who has been the drummer of the hard rock band Def Leppard since 1978.

November 1st 1981

Tommy Karevik – Kamelot

Tommy Karevik is a Swedish metal vocalist. He is the lead singer of Kamelot and former lead vocalist of Seventh Wonder.
